On 03/04/2016 09:23 PM, Douglas Anderson wrote:

 From testing and trying to make sense of the documentation, it appears
that a 10 ms delay is needed after resetting the core to make sure that
everything is stable and consistent.  Let's add it.

In my testing (on rk3288) this allows us to revert commit
192cb07f7928 ("usb: dwc2: Fix probe problem on bcm2835").  Though I
could never reproduce the problems on my board, this might also allow us
to revert commit bd84f4ae9986 ("usb: dwc2: Add extra delay when forcing
dr_mode").
